Program Overview

This program is a combination of the curriculum and instruction Master’s degree program in school health education and multi-age licensure in health education. Students analyze and interpret current research in the health field and become knowledgeable in areas of primary concern, such as nutrition and substance abuse in the schools. Particular focus is placed on recent developments and trends in health fields. Two program options are available: (1) Master’s degree and second licensure for current holders of a multi-age license and (2) Master’s degree and initial licensure for persons without a current teaching license.
